We would recommend you not book Room 8600 on the RC Serenade. Balcony is 1/2 normal size. Room is on a curve. Guest pays normal price but gets a balcony that is not usable for two adults. *Food- A+ We found the meals to be excellent especially the chef recomended each night. *Service- A+ Our dining staff were great. We did not have any problems with them. Buffet was great for lunch. ...

we chose this cruise due to its price and the itinerary. the countries were beautiful and the excursions were very fun, however almost everything on the boat is an upcharge of a ridiculous amount. alcoholic drinks were near 20$, the internet was slow and just about 100$ for a week for only one device, t shirts are near 30$, 24 water bottles were 36$. ended up almost spent another 1000$ just for ...
